Don't know if this has been posted anywhere, if so please point me to it, I didn't find anything searching...

I've seen a few Choo Choo Customs, 83-87, and some had the door jamb sticker but in 2 instances, the sequencing of the numbers were different. One had the last 6 digits of the VIN in the middle and another had it at the end. for example:

CCC/xxxxxx/EBP-2x

the other:

CCC/EBP4-5xx/xxxxxx

Are both correct or only one way? Also one didn't have any body side moldings and didn't have have the train emblem on the dash (it actually had the "Super Sport" dash emblem) and the other had two-tone paint and the dash train emblem.

Is there any definitive way for this sticker to be typed out? Does anybody have any pics of the sticker on a car that is definitely a true Choo Choo?

The one that looks typed correctly doesn't have the train emblem, and the one the typing doesn't look right it does have the train emblem, plus optional sidepipes.

theoriginalbowtie wrote:

CCC/xxxxxx/EBP-2x

the other:

CCC/EBP4-5xx/xxxxxx

Are both correct or only one way?

They are both correct. In the 83-84 Choo Choo, the six numbers from the VIN were inserted in the center, but from 85 through 87 the six numbers from the VIN were inserted at the end.
